Authenticated process corruption via undisclosed buffer overflow
Published Jan 2, 2026 · Updated Jan 2, 2026
Stack-based buffer overflow in QNAP QTS 5.2.x and QuTS hero h5.2.x and h5.3.x allows remote authenticated users to corrupt process memory. QNAP has not disclosed the affected component or the operation that overruns a stack buffer with attacker-controlled input. An administrator account is required; exploitation can modify process memory or crash processes, with no published code-execution impact.

Is a vulnerable build present?
Compare these published version ranges with your installed build and any vendor patches.
- Affected versionversion=h5.2.x <h5.2.7.3256 build 20250913
- Affected versionversion=h5.3.x <h5.3.1.3250 build 20250912
